Unity Google Drive 开源项目教程
unity-googledriveGoogle Drive for Unity3D项目地址:https://gitcode.com/gh_mirrors/un/unity-googledrive
1. 项目的目录结构及介绍
unity-googledrive/
├── Assets/
│ ├── Plugins/
│ │ ├── com.elringus.unitygoogledriveandroid.aar
│ │ └── com.elringus.unitygoogledriveios.aar
│ └── Scripts/
│ └── UnityGoogleDrive/
│ ├── Controllers/
│ ├── Data/
│ ├── Helpers/
│ ├── Managers/
│ └── Providers/
├── Packages/
│ └── manifest.json
├── ProjectSettings/
│ └── ProjectSettings.asset
├── README.md
├── LICENSE
├── UnityGoogleDrive.unitypackage
└── publish.sh
- Assets/: 包含项目的所有资源文件,包括插件和脚本。
- Plugins/: 包含适用于不同平台的插件文件,如Android和iOS。
- Scripts/: 包含项目的所有脚本文件,其中
UnityGoogleDrive/
目录下是与Google Drive API相关的脚本。
- Packages/: 包含项目的包管理文件
manifest.json
。 - ProjectSettings/: 包含项目的设置文件
ProjectSettings.asset
。 - README.md: 项目的说明文档。
- LICENSE: 项目的许可证文件。
- UnityGoogleDrive.unitypackage: 项目的Unity包文件。
- publish.sh: 项目的发布脚本。
2. 项目的启动文件介绍
项目的启动文件主要是UnityGoogleDrive.unitypackage
,这是一个Unity包文件,包含了项目所需的所有资源和脚本。通过导入这个包文件,可以在Unity项目中快速集成Google Drive SDK。
3. 项目的配置文件介绍
- manifest.json: 位于
Packages/
目录下,用于管理项目的依赖包。 - ProjectSettings.asset: 位于
ProjectSettings/
目录下,包含项目的各种设置,如构建设置、编辑器设置等。 - AndroidManifest.xml: 位于
Assets/Plugins/com.elringus.unitygoogledriveandroid.aar
中,需要解压aar
文件获取,用于配置Android应用的权限和标识。 - Info.plist: 对于iOS平台,需要在Unity的iOS播放器设置中添加应用的ID(小写)到支持的URL schemes列表中。
以上是Unity Google Drive开源项目的目录结构、启动文件和配置文件的介绍。通过这些信息,可以更好地理解和使用该项目。
unity-googledriveGoogle Drive for Unity3D项目地址:https://gitcode.com/gh_mirrors/un/unity-googledrive
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考